Maintainability Engineer Job Description Sample
Reliability & Maintainability Engineer
The Reliability & Maintainability Engineer provides Bell commercial and military programs with professional Reliability, Maintainability and Testability engineering support through professional techniques and processes.
Position Responsibilities:
Collect, analyze and score Failure Reporting, Analysis and Corrective Action System (FRACAS) data. Perform Root Cause Analysis (RCA), Engineering Investigations (EI) and Corrective Action Plans (CAP) for failed aircraft components including participation in Reliability Review scoring boards.
Perform Failure Modes, Effects and Criticality Analyses (FMECA) and testability assessments including Highly Accelerated Life Testing (HALT), Highly Accelerated Stress Screening (HASS), fault detection and fault isolation.
Assess manufacturing parametrics and maintenance removal times.
Formulate reliability analyses and predictions (including development of failure rate estimates based on handbook techniques and historical data) using Windchill Quality Solutions software.
Perform budget estimating.

Reliability & Maintainability Engineer (2400 Nasa Parkway)
Reliability & Maintainability Engineer (2400 NASA Parkway)
Description
I.PURPOSE/FUNCTION (JOB SUMMARY)
Works with NASA customer to originate and develop analysis methods to determine reliability, maintainability and availability of systems.Basic roles are to evaluate the ability of components, equipment and processes to perform their intended function under stated conditions for a given period of time, can be repaired in a defined environment within a specified time and showing the probability that a system is operational at any given time under a given set of environmental conditions.Candidate acquires and analyzes data. Prepares diagrams, charts, drawings, calculations and reports to define reliability problems and make recommendations for improvements. Conducts analysis of reliability/maintainability/availability problems and investigates to determine the required approach for a particular situation, with consideration given to cost limitations for equipment uptime/downtime, repair/replacement costs and weight, size and availability of materials/equipment. Determines cost advantages of alternatives and develops action plans that comply with internal/external customer demands for reliable processes/equipment to avoid failures.

Reliability, Maintainability And Supportability (Rm&S) Engineer / ADP
Job Description: :
Lockheed Martin Advanced Programs
- Reliability, Maintainability, and Supportability (RM&S) engineer for Advanced Development Programs. The candidate will be familiar with RM&S analysis methods, including reliability predictions and allocations, mission reliability analysis, failure modes and effects analysis, maintainability predictions (mean time to repair, crew size), maintenance task analysis, prognostics, diagnostics, health management, scheduled maintenance, timeline analysis, human factors, logistics footprint, support equipment requirements, manpower requirements, and sortie generation rate.
The applicant will perform trade studies to establish system, segment, and equipment RM&S requirements, assess their performance, and influence the design. The candidate will also participate in establishing RM&S requirements for conceptual designs based on customer needs, state-of-the-art technology capabilities, and program level performance requirements. These requirements will be established in system, segment,
and equipment specifications and contractor and supplier statements of work.
Develops and maintains program RM&S processes.
Establishes RM&S technical performance measures (TPMs). Coordinates internal RM&S technical reviews. Establishes and maintains RM&S IPT risks, opportunities, and issues.
Serves as the focal point for release of RM&S technical data outside the RM&S IPT. Develops and maintains system reliability and availability models.
